Log nicht auf Basis von 10, gibt es da ne Funktion.



  • Gibt es eine Funktion wo ich das z.b. berechnen kann log_a(b), also das Logarithmus von b mit der Basis a?. Ader sollte ich das so berechnen log(15)/log(3)?.

    Vielen dank im Voraus.



  • In der Standardbibliothek gibt es noch ln(), in vielen Mathebibliotheken befinden sich aber weit mächtigere Logarithmen-Funktionen bei denen die Basis auch angegeben werden kann.

    Ansonsten mit der Standardformel umrechnen:

    log[t]10[/t](a)
    log[t]b[/t](a) = --------
              log[t]10[/t](b)
    

    MfG SideWinder



  • kennst du eine gute mathelib, die auch größere zahlen unterstützt?


Log in to reply